技术方案总结:基于云计算的数字人事管理平台构建
一、项目概述
随着云计算技术的快速发展,企业对于数字人事管理的依赖度越来越高。传统的数字人事管理在数据处理、安全性以及扩展性等方面都难以满足企业的需求。因此,本项目旨在构建一种基于云计算的数字人事管理平台,通过云计算技术实现高效、安全、智能的数字人事管理。
二、技术方案
1.技术架构
本项目采用云计算技术进行构建,采用阿里云ECS服务器作为技术平台。前端使用Vue.js框架,实现用户登录、数据展示等功能;后端使用Spring Boot框架,实现数据处理、业务逻辑等功能;数据库采用MySQL,确保数据的安全性。
2. 功能模块
2.1 用户管理
用户管理是数字人事管理的基础,本项目提供用户注册、登录、权限管理等功能。用户登录成功后,可以进行个人信息修改、删除,以及各项数字人事操作。
2.2 数字人事管理
数字人事管理是数字人事管理平台的核心,本项目提供员工信息管理、薪资管理、考勤管理等业务功能。员工信息管理包括员工基本信息、联系方式等管理;薪资管理包括薪资标准、薪资结构等管理;考勤管理包括请假、迟到、扣分等考勤管理。
2.3 数据分析
数据分析是数字人事管理平台的附加功能,本项目可统计数字人事管理中的各种数据,如员工考勤情况、薪资结构等,为管理人员提供数据参考依据。
三、系统架构设计
系统架构设计是整个数字人事管理平台的骨架,直接影响到系统的性能和安全性。本项目的系统架构设计采用微服务架构,将数字人事管理中各个模块进行独立部署,实现各模块间的解耦。通过API网关进行统一访问控制,确保系统安全。同时,采用容器化部署,实现系统弹性伸缩。
四、项目实施与部署
4.1 项目实施
本项目在阿里云ECS服务器上进行实施,采用敏捷开发模式,进行迭代式开发。在项目实施过程中,采用Git进行代码管理,确保代码的稳定性和可维护性。同时,使用Jenkins进行持续集成,确保代码的及时修复。
4.2 系统部署
系统采用Docker进行打包,实现快速部署。通过Kubernetes进行容器编排,实现高可用、负载均衡。此外,采用Prometheus进行系统监控,确保系统稳定运行。
五、项目运行状况
5.1 运行环境
系统采用阿里云ECS服务器进行运行,采用Linux操作系统,进行系统安装与配置。服务器配置如下:
CPU:2核
内存:4GB
存储:50GB SSD
网络:公网IP
5.2 运行结果
系统运行以来,运行稳定,运行效率高。通过Prometheus统计系统资源使用情况,确保系统安全可靠。目前,系统已稳定运行3个月,未出现明显的性能瓶颈。
六、项目总结
本文介绍了一种基于云计算的数字人事管理平台构建方法。该平台采用微服务架构,实现各模块间的解耦,确保系统安全。同时,采用容器化部署,实现系统弹性伸缩。在项目实施过程中,采用敏捷开发模式,进行迭代式开发,确保项目的顺利进行。通过系统部署,确保系统的稳定运行,为管理人员提供高效、安全、智能的数字人事管理。